Themed Elements Removed From NBA Experience at Disney Springs

Panels gone from NBA Experience

Four years after permanently closing the NBA Experience at Disney Springs, Disney has begun to remove some of the building’s theming. NBA Experience Construction The NBA Experience took over what was previously DisneyQuest. As the NBA Experience, the building featured a wave of large silver panels across the roof’s edge. Milwaukee Bucks Boycott NBA Playoffs Game at ESPN Wide World of Sports Complex Over Jacob Blake Shooting; All Games Today Postponed

The Milwaukee Bucks have boycotted today’s scheduled NBA Playoffs game in protest of the shooting of Jacob Blake in Kenosha, Wisconsin by police officers, according to ESPN.
